The Role

As a Manager, Alternative Fund Accounting you will have responsibilities covering all aspects of billing and expense operations supporting client and fund fee processes. You will work closely with associates across the business and act as a primary contact for daily operational needs, while providing direction, leadership, and support in collaboration with partners across the organization. The role requires expertise in monthly and quarterly deliverables, business performance evaluation, and stakeholder management.

This role is an individual contributor position at the manager level and requires a hands-on approach to executing complex billing activities, including management and performance fee calculations, while helping to enhance processes and controls.

In addition to operational responsibilities, you will contribute to improving workflows, supporting key initiatives, and collaborating with internal teams including Fund Accounting, Institutional Client Services, Corporate Accounting, and more.

The Team

The Billing & Expense team is part of the Fund Operations division within Fidelity's Fund and Investment Operations (FFIO) business unit. The Fund Operations division provides back office operational support to Fidelity Retail and Institutional products, including books and records maintenance, securities' pricing, fund and security level performance analysis, financial reporting, and tax work. The team is responsible for client billing and fund-related fee processes, including management and performance fee calculations. The team supports monthly and quarterly deliverables, ensuring accurate invoicing, strong controls, and efficient operations across products and stakeholders.
